Bro, I was told Celcom only provide conditional call forwarding e.g. forward when unavailable, when busy, when out of coverage, when not answer. Unconditional forward all calls is not available.
Can you help to confirm that whether first gold plan can do unconditional call forwarding with the following gsm commands?
Unconditional call forwarding
*21*phone number#
To undo : #21#

The feature of unconditional call forward is that all incoming calls will be forwarded while your phone can remain on with mobile coverage to receive only data and sms.
